I use to shoot plastic,but prefer to use fibre nowadays,simply because my shooting is mainly over land holding livestock,and to be perfectly honest i dont think theres much between them.Yes i know fibre costs a little more per-thou,but most people like you to use fibre around where i am,even most of the local clay shoots are switching from plastic over to fibre,and if you have a good day over the decoys and do use plastic i will always try to clear up as many shot-cups as i can find at the end of the session,it only takes a few minutes to clear up,but could take some while to find a new shoot if you upset the farmer

Try this one,buy yourself a pigeon cradle but just the one,about 3 quid then go to your local dry-cleaners and ask for a few wire-coat hangers(most will give for free)but worst case will cost u 10p each,then when you have some spare time duplicate the bought cradle with the coat hanger,takes about 3 mins per cradle,spray black .Once you have a few crows down in your patten remove decoys for dead birds on cradles,much the same as you would for pigeon,and they move in the wind as they arent as rigid as the shop bought ones,and if you loose one or two,at that price you wont really be too upset,and if you still have problems getting the crows in,spray them grey and try for pigeon
